Web29 jun. 2024 · Four-fifths of US workers don't have access to any paid parental leave (Credit: Alamy) Over the next two decades, European and Latin American countries … WebIMandatory paid job-protected maternity leave legislated in 1957. IUntil 1974, six weeks of leave prior to birth were mandated.Reform in April 1974 increased duration toeightweeks. IMandatory postnatal leave was also extended from six to eight weeks IBeginning of prenatal leave is estimated based upon thedoctor’s esti- mation of date of delivery.
